How to Determine a Dependable Accredited Specialist for Your Home Project

Identifying a trusted licensed service provider entails complete research and careful consideration. Right here are some crucial elements to evaluate when looking for a service provider for your home project:

1. Understand What a Certified Specialist Is

Before diving into the world of contractors, it is necessary to understand what "licensed" suggests in this context. A qualified specialist has met details state needs that show their competence in numerous building jobs. This includes having passed necessary exams and maintaining required insurance.

2. Why Licensing Matters in Building And Construction Projects

Licensing issues because it secures property owners from potential fraudulence and makes certain that contractors follow sector criteria. 3. Research Study Local Licensing Requirements

Each state has its own licensing needs for specialists. Familiarize on your own with these regulations by checking your state's licensing board site. This expertise will certainly help you recognize what credentials to search for when assessing possible contractors.

4. Start with Recommendations from Buddies and Family

Word of mouth can be among one of the most efficient means to discover a trustworthy service provider. Ask pals, relative, or neighbors that have actually just recently undertaken comparable jobs about their experiences and recommendations.

5. Use Online Resources and Reviews

In addition to individual recommendations, on-line systems such as Yelp, Angie's Checklist, or Google Reviews can provide valuable insights right into contractors' credibilities. Search for constant positive responses regarding their job high quality and consumer service.

6. Evaluate Portfolios of Potential Contractors

A picture deserves a thousand words; as a result, examining a service provider's profile can offer you insight into their capabilities and style. Demand samples of previous job that line up with your task's vision.

7. Validate Licenses and Insurance Coverage

Once you have actually shortlisted prospective service providers, verify their licenses via your state's licensing board internet site. In addition, examine if they carry appropriate insurance protection-- this must consist of basic liability insurance policy as well as employees' compensation.

8. Analyze Experience in Certain Projects Similar to Yours

Not all contractors focus on every sort of building and construction task. Guarantee that the service provider you select has significant experience with projects comparable to yours-- be it improvements, brand-new constructions, or specialized tasks like electric or pipes work.

9. Inquire about Subcontractors and Their Qualifications

Many certified specialists use subcontractors for specialized jobs such as electric job or plumbing installments. It's necessary to ask about these subcontractors' certifications and guarantee they are also licensed where necessary.

11. Significance of Created Agreements in Construction Projects

Having a created contract secures both parties involved-- the property owner and the service provider-- by plainly detailing expectations concerning timelines, budgets, and responsibilities throughout the job lifecycle.

12. Understand Settlement Frameworks: What's Typical?

Most specialists ask for an ahead of time down payment adhered to by landmark settlements based on completed stages of work as opposed to paying whatever upfront which is high-risk from a homeowner's perspective.
